Boot Mobility Scooters

Boot mobility scooters are perfect for those who are less mobile, typically due to illness or disability. They are light and easy to dismantle. This makes them the ideal solution for those who require an easy mobility scooter fit in car boot solution.

They are easy to fold or dismantled for easy transportation and storage in the trunk of your car. They are also a great choice for those who have limited storage space at home.

Easy to dismantle

Boot scooters are simple to disassemble and store in the trunk of a car for transport. They are an excellent choice for people who have limitations in mobility and need to transport their scooter during vacation or out in public.

Mobility scooters come in many sizes and shapes The best ones can be folded or removed quickly and easily so that transportation is easier. You can take them on trips or even store them under your stairs at home.

The size of the battery and motor are vital considerations when purchasing a dismantleable electric scooter. Smaller motors and batteries will not travel as far or make as many climbs as larger models so make sure you choose the best one for your needs.

Easy to fold

If you're looking for a mobility scooter that is easy to fold and store, look no more than the boot mobility scooters. These scooters can be dismantled into five or four pieces, and tucked away in vehicle's boot which makes them an ideal option for those who need a scooter can be carried wherever they go.

There are various kinds of folding scooters. Some are equipped with manual folding mechanisms, some have an automated folding mechanism. Auto-folding models are becoming increasingly popular due to the fact that they can be folded at the push of a single button. This makes them safer and convenient to keep at home.

my-mobility-scoooters-logo-red-png.pngThese scooters are also very popular due to their ability to fit into most car boot spaces. They're also lightweight so it's much easier to lift them up and then out of the vehicle.

The best way to find out which folding mobility scooter portable car boot folding lightweight scooter is best for you is to speak to a mobility professional at your local store. They will be able to explain the characteristics and Boot Mobility Scooter help you select the right one for your needs.

A foldable scooter is also great for traveling, as they can be easily tucked in the trunk of your car or stored in a luggage compartment on an airplane. There are also suitcase-style mobility scooters for travelers that can be pushed behind the user, allowing them to navigate airports swiftly. This is particularly helpful for people with a lower mobility.

The average range of a folding mobility scooter is 10 miles. This is ideal for most people. However, it's important to keep in mind that the user's weight and the type of terrain they're travelling on can affect the maximum range of a mobility scooter portable car boot folding lightweight scooter that folds.

Folding travel scooters are cheaper and easier to repair than other types of scooters. Additionally, they are also light and easy to store in your car or on a plane.

Easy to transport

A boot mobility scooter can be dismantled easily to fit into the boot of a car. They are portable and can be taken wherever. The seat and battery pack can be removed easily and the scooter's chassis can be divided into two pieces that can fit into a car boot.

There are a variety of scooter models on the market. Each model caters to specific needs. Before you decide on the best model, you must consider the purpose for which you intend to use it and for what purpose.

Speed is also a factor to consider when selecting the right mobility scooter for your. The majority of scooters operate at a speed of between four and eight miles per hour, enough to travel around town or shopping malls but if you're planning for a long journey, you may want to consider a more powerful model that can withstand more rugged terrain.

If you're searching for a scooter with an easy-to use lift system, as well as a trunk storage space, look for one that has a storage compartment. The trunk compartment should be large enough to accommodate the scooter, and additional supplies, such as a charger and a spare battery.

They can be a fantastic option for travel. They are typically lightweight and compact making them a perfect choice for airplane travel.

However, they aren't as versatile as other mobility aids and they are not able to handle challenging terrain or hard-packed ground. They are not suitable for those who want to take their scooters off-road.

Pick a folding scooter that is sturdy and able to withstand wear and tear. Some models can be repaired by local service providers.

The aid for mobility should be lightweight, which means that it is easy to lift and transport into the trunk of the car. This is particularly crucial for older people who may become tired or unable to lift weights as they get older.
